Moisture levels in internal walls are crucial for maintaining a healthy and comfortable living environment. Excessive moisture can lead to mold growth, structural damage, and health problems. Regular moisture monitoring is essential to identify and address issues promptly.
The ideal moisture content for internal walls is between 4% and 6% by weight. This range ensures optimal conditions for both the occupants and the structural integrity of the building. Higher moisture levels, such as above 10%, can cause damage and pose health risks.
* Mold Growth: Moisture-loving mold thrives in environments with high humidity levels. Mold can cause respiratory issues, allergies, and structural damage.
* Structural Damage: Excess moisture can weaken building materials, leading to cracks, warping, and rotting.
* Health Problems: Damp walls can exacerbate respiratory conditions and contribute to condensation, creating a breeding ground for dust mites.
